Awiti is a young Tokaya Ge'Za shaman and the wife of prince Ther'Os Wacha of the Ahkis clan. She was saved by the Abunese during the second Abunese-Zonizan war. She's born with a gift given by the spirits (i.e. she suffers of epilepsy) that let her see visions without drinking the Eter, the sacred potion of the Ge'Za shamans. Thanks to her powers, the Zonizans settled in the camp where her and her tribe lived during the war, but after she told a wrong prediction, the Zonizans took revenge by killing all the tribesmen, setting the camp on fire, while she was beaten, raped and the tip of her tail cut, leaving her for dead.
The Abunese army made its way towards the camp, pushing the remaning Zonizans away, and she was found by prince Ther'Os, agonizing. She was taken to the Abunese camp, where her wounds were treated and she got attached to the Abunese prince. After the war, she was taken at the Royal palace and kept as a hostage by Kaliendra, and in that period, she confessed her feelings towards Ther'Os. One year later, the two married and she gave birth to a daughter.
